Job Description:
The COMSEC Custodian assists the Sr.
COMSEC Manager in performing the functions and responsibilities of securing equipment, materials, and information.
The person selected for this position be responsible for the administration of policies and procedures to ensure compliance with the NISPOM, DoD IC Manuals, and L3Harris policies and procedures.
The COMSEC Custodian works closely with the Facility Security Officer (FSO) and the Contractor Program Security Officer (CPSO) to ensure that the facility's security programs are executed effectively and efficiently
Essential Functions:
Assist in the management of all procurement, fielding, and sustainment of Crypto/Keying material and devices.
Establish, maintain, and direct the receipt, custody, transfer, safeguarding, accounting, and destruction/disposition of the COMSEC keying material.
Ensure maximum COMSEC safeguards are in place.
Manage proper accountability, handling, storage, packaging, shipment, and administration of all cryptographic materials, troubleshooting, software upgrades, and system equipment certifications.
Conduct initial and refresher training of all COMSEC users.
Administer initial COMSEC/CRYPTO briefings and debriefings to individual users; maintaining concise records to reflect changes.
Perform COMSEC inventories.
Review annually the requirement for COMSEC material.
Issue COMSEC materials to user activities.
Provide technical and administrative support to COMSEC equipment holders, ensuring proper handling and documentation of policies and procedures.
Ensure COMSEC element accounts comply with NSA policies.
Update and maintain all SOP's for COMSEC activities.
Develop and conduct COMSEC training for users and local elements.
Maintain access list for Controlled/Closed Area designations.
Assist with physical security responsibilities, to include access control, IDS management, and entry/exit inspections.
Assist with Personnel Security functions, to include fingerprinting and employee/visitor badging.
Assist program management in the interpretation, application, and compliance in accordance with Security Classification Guides (SCG's).
Assist the FSO and CPSO to meet NISPOM, SCI, and SAP manual standards.
Participate in government agency audits, reviews, and inspections.
Maintain an understanding of the selected programs' technologies and maintain a thorough understanding of the customers' security requirements.
Must be able to complete the NSA COR COMSEC Course within 6 months of being hired.
Additional duties as assigned.

Don't Be Fooled

The fraudster will send a check to the victim who has accepted a job. The check can be for multiple reasons such as signing bonus, supplies, etc. The victim will be instructed to deposit the check and use the money for any of these reasons and then instructed to send the remaining funds to the fraudster. The check will bounce and the victim is left responsible.
